Core Insights - The 2025 Smart Agriculture and Service Trade Conference highlighted the rapid digital and intelligent transformation of China's agriculture sector, showcasing over a hundred agricultural enterprises from more than 20 provinces [1] - The conference served as a platform for resource integration and innovation in smart agriculture, facilitating the transition of technology from laboratories to practical applications in the field [1] Policy Support - The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s issued the "National Smart Agriculture Action Plan (2024-2028)" to enhance smart agriculture through existing projects and policies, aiming for a coordinated policy framework [2] - Financial institutions are encouraged to establish differentiated credit assessment systems for technology innovation in agriculture, with increased credit loan limits for smart agriculture and related sectors [2] Local Initiatives - Beijing's implementation plan for smart agriculture aims for comprehensive data coverage and utilization in rural areas by 2030, enhancing the value of agricultural data [3] Technological Innovation - A report from Beihai City indicated that 77.7% of respondents believe smart agriculture technologies have reduced production costs and improved efficiency, while 63% noted enhancements in product quality and economic benefits [5] - Digital agriculture demonstration zones in Jiangsu and Hebei have achieved a 15% increase in water and fertilizer utilization efficiency and a 10% increase in yield per unit area [5] - The market size for smart agriculture and related industries in China is expected to exceed 120 billion yuan by 2025, with an annual growth rate of around 15% [5] Industry Significance - Smart agriculture is seen as essential for achieving high-quality development in the agricultural sector, addressing challenges such as low production efficiency and resource constraints [6]

Core Viewpoint - The first Smart Agriculture Innovation Competition, guided by the Chinese Farmers' Harvest Festival Organization Committee and hosted by the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s and the Zhejiang Provincial Department of Agriculture and Rural Affairs, highlights the need for financial support to bridge the gap between laboratory results and market application in smart agriculture [1] Group 1: Financial Support Mechanisms - Banks should establish a "competition linkage + special credit" mechanism to support high-quality projects emerging from the Smart Agriculture Innovation Competition, considering intellectual property value and commercialization prospects during project evaluation [1] - A targeted "low interest + long term" special credit scheme should be designed for early-stage tech-driven agricultural enterprises, covering the entire process from technological breakthroughs to mass production [1][2] - Banks can introduce specialized products like "Agricultural Machinery Loans" using a combination of equipment collateral and expected revenue pledges to address the lack of collateral among agricultural operators [2] Group 2: Digital Transformation and Risk Management - The digital attributes of smart agriculture provide banks with important technological support to enhance service quality, enabling "sensitive credit and precise risk control" through real-time data from field sensors [3] - Banks can integrate agricultural big data platforms to build dynamic risk control models based on equipment utilization, output efficiency, and repayment ability [3] - Online channels can facilitate the entire loan process for agricultural operators using smart equipment, allowing for flexible adjustments in credit limits based on real-time monitoring of production conditions [3] Group 3: Collaborative Ecosystem Development - The healthy development of smart agriculture requires collaboration among government departments, banks, enterprises, research institutions, and farmers [3] - Banks can act as a financial hub, facilitating a "bank-government-research-enterprise" platform and developing insurance products to mitigate risks associated with smart agricultural technologies [3][4] - The focus should be on technology innovation, scene-driven demands, and ecosystem building to ensure that financial resources are effectively channeled into the agricultural sector [4]

每经记者|陈晴 每经编辑|董兴生 图片来源:企业供图 记者手记:期待农户与企业收获更多科技"果实" 10月7日,《每日经济新闻》记者探访了位于武汉市岱家山科创城的武汉四信智农机电设备有限公司(以下简称"武汉四信智农")。采访中了解 到,这是一家今年刚成立的新公司。团队之前在智慧水利领域积累了多年经验,之所以选择进入农业赛道,正是看中了这一领域的广阔前景和当前 的政策支持力度,特别是国家对智慧农业和新农村建设的大力扶持。 在政策的支持下,智慧农业迎来了发展的春天。但作为人类最古老的行业,农业的智能化转型依然道阻且长。 在采访中,记者也感受到,一家初创企业要想在这片领域扎根成长,并不容易。一个细节可见一斑:尽管从事智慧农业业务,该公司的试验场地却 十分有限。目前,他们只能通过在办公区周围的走道上摆放泡沫箱、种植植物,来进行初步试验。 武汉四信智农工作人员介绍,如今AI(人工智能)已经广泛应用于智慧农业的各个环节,比如气象监测、虫情监测、苗情监测、土壤墒情监测、精 准施肥、精准灌溉等。可以说,传统农业现在也能用上一整套AI信息化解决方案。 以浇水和施肥为例,通过智能化水肥一体机自动灌溉系统,传感器可以实时监测土壤的 ...

Core Insights - The event showcased innovations in smart agriculture, featuring robots and drones designed to enhance efficiency in farming tasks such as weeding, transporting, and monitoring crops [1][6] - The competition attracted 55 teams from 26 companies and 17 research institutions, highlighting the growing interest and investment in agricultural technology [1] Group 1: Weeding Robots - The targeted spraying weeding robot developed by Anhui Hefei Duojia Agricultural Technology Co., Ltd. can operate on 1 acre of land in under 1 minute, reducing pesticide usage by 30% to 80% compared to traditional methods [3] - The robot features an online mixing technology and dual spraying system, improving pesticide utilization and minimizing environmental pollution [3] Group 2: Transport Robots - The smart transport unmanned vehicle from Zhejiang Hangzhou Shennongshi Robot Co., Ltd. integrates various self-developed technologies, enabling it to navigate and avoid obstacles autonomously [5] - The new generation greenhouse transport robot GHBOT-02, developed by Beijing Agricultural College, utilizes low-cost 2D laser radar technology, reducing hardware costs by over 90% compared to traditional 3D laser radar [5] Group 3: Monitoring Drones - Drones demonstrated capabilities in quickly measuring field areas and identifying crops, providing data analysis and recommendations for farmers [6] - The drones can complete monitoring tasks for 50-60 acres in about 10 minutes, significantly improving efficiency compared to manual labor [6] Group 4: Future of Smart Agriculture - The event served as a platform to showcase China's achievements in smart agriculture and promote the digital transformation of the agricultural sector [6] - Experts predict that the future of smart agriculture will focus on automation, precision, and intelligence, contributing to the modernization of agriculture [6]
